2015-09-28 94 views
0

我试图在变量名称上点击特定的文本区域后,亲爱的。任何帮助如何做到这一点?在文本区域中放置文本字段

clientname = Ext.create('Ext.form.TextField', { 
     id : 'client_name', 
     fieldLabel: 'Client Name', 
     width :'20%' 
    }); 


function onButtonClick(){  
    name=Ext.getCmp('client_name').getValue(); 
} 

result = Ext.create('Ext.form.FormPanel', { 
     width  : 400, 
     bodyPadding: 0, 
     id:'outcome', 
     items: [{ 

      xtype  : 'textareafield', 
      name  : 'message', 
      anchor : '100%', 
      readOnly : true, 
      value  : 'Dear' 
     }] 
    }); 

回答

0

获取您的textarea和您的文本字段的值,并连接这些值。

function onButtonClick(){  
    var textField = Ext.ComponentQuery.query('textfield[id=client_name]'), 
     textArea = Ext.ComponentQuery.query('textareafield[name=message]'); 

    textArea.setValue(textArea.getValue() + textField.getValue()); 
}